Darlington Prov Park Clean Up
Our camping organization has this project where we are allowed into the Provincial Park before the actual opening date and we do odd jobs around the park as a project. We clean the sites, rake leaves, paint signs, clean the beach etc. The Park provides all the necesssary tools and supplies and in return for this work, we get 2 nights free after Labour Day weekend.
The Rangers and people working in the park do not have enough time or resources to do these jobs, so for them its a very important part of their operations budget.
Last year most of us returned for Thanksgiving at the Park.
Its a great day and we are looking forward to it. We will be there on April 29, 30 and May 1. Our group is Family Campers and RVers and other chapters do the same in other areas of Ontario and across the US as well.
Its our way of making sure that these Public Parks are open for the future generations.
